[C++ 学习] C++ primer 第4版 习题4.19


using std::cin;
using std::cout;
using std::endl;
using std::vector;
using std::string;

int main()
	int i;					//	okay,but haven't initialized
	const int ic;			//	wrong : const value must be initialized
	const int *pic;			//	okay.The pointer wants to point to a const value(not const is also valid).
	int *const cpi;			//	wrong : the const pointer should be initialized.
	const int *const cpic;		//	wrong : the const pointer wants to point to a const value.
								//			as a const pointer, it must be initialized.
	return 0;

